Positioning the GigaSwitch
Before you choose a location for the GigaSwitch, observe the following guidelines:
•Keep cabling away from sources of electrical noise, power lines, and fluorescent lighting fixtures.
•Position the GigaSwitch away from water and moisture sources.
•To ensure adequate air flow around the GigaSwitch, be sure to provide a minimum of one inch (25mm) clearance.
